![]() One of the more widely used applications for accelerometers is tilt-sensing. You'll see acceleration displayed either in units of meters per second squared (m/s 2), or G-force (g), which is about 9.8m/s 2 (the exact value depends on your elevation and the mass of the planet you're on).Īccelerometers are used to sense both static (e.g. You know.how fast something is speeding up or slowing down. What's an accelerometer measure? Well, acceleration.
